Real estate in Mijas, Spain
Mijas, located on the Costa del Sol in Spain, is a picturesque coastal town known for its stunning views, charming whitewashed buildings, and a blend of traditional Spanish culture with modern amenities. This area attracts a diverse range of buyers, including retirees seeking a tranquil lifestyle, expatriates looking for a second home, and investors interested in rental properties. The Mijas real estate market is characterized by a variety of property types, from luxurious villas to more modest apartments, appealing to both high-end buyers and those seeking affordable options in a desirable location.
When considering a property purchase in Mijas, potential buyers should familiarize themselves with local customs and regulations. The buying process typically involves securing a Spanish lawyer to assist with the transaction, understanding the local market dynamics, and being aware of the necessary documentation, such as obtaining a Spanish tax identification number (NIE). Foreign buyers should also consider the importance of a thorough due diligence process, which includes property inspections and verifying ownership details.
In terms of pricing, Mijas generally offers competitive rates compared to neighboring areas like Fuengirola and Marbella, which are known for their upscale properties. Factors influencing property prices in Mijas include proximity to the coast, size of the property, and its overall condition. The price range in Mijas reflects a broad spectrum, catering to various budgets, which indicates a healthy market with opportunities for both buyers and investors.
For those navigating the Mijas real estate market, it is advisable to conduct comprehensive inspections prior to purchase, focusing on structural integrity, potential renovation needs, and the overall condition of the property. Common pitfalls include overlooking the importance of local zoning laws and potential hidden costs, such as community fees or property taxes.
